PHP Class eZ\Bundle\EzPublishCoreBundle\Tests\ConfigResolverTest

Inheritance: extends PHPUnit_Framework_TestCas\PHPUnit_Framework_TestCase
Afficher le fichier Open project: ezsystems/ezpublish-kernel

Méthodes publiques

Méthode Description
hasParameterProvider ( )
parameterProvider ( )
testGetParameterDefaultScope ( $paramName, $expectedValue )
testGetParameterFailedNull ( )
testGetParameterFailedWithException ( )
testGetParameterGlobalScope ( $paramName, $expectedValue )
testGetParameterRelativeScope ( $paramName, $expectedValue )
testGetParameterSpecificScope ( $paramName, $expectedValue )
testGetSetDefaultScope ( )
testGetSetUndefinedStrategy ( )
testHasParameterNoNamespace ( $defaultMatch, $groupMatch, $scopeMatch, $globalMatch, $expectedResult )
testHasParameterWithNamespaceAndScope ( $defaultMatch, $groupMatch, $scopeMatch, $globalMatch, $expectedResult )

Méthodes protégées

Méthode Description
setUp ( )

Private Methods

Méthode Description
getResolver ( string $defaultNS = 'ezsettings', integer $undefinedStrategy = ConfigResolver::UNDEFINED_STRATEGY_EXCEPTION, array $groupsBySiteAccess = [] ) : ConfigResolver

Method Details

hasParameterProvider() public méthode

parameterProvider() public méthode

public parameterProvider ( )

setUp() protected méthode

protected setUp ( )

testGetParameterDefaultScope() public méthode

public testGetParameterDefaultScope ( $paramName, $expectedValue )

testGetParameterFailedNull() public méthode

testGetParameterFailedWithException() public méthode

testGetParameterGlobalScope() public méthode

public testGetParameterGlobalScope ( $paramName, $expectedValue )

testGetParameterRelativeScope() public méthode

public testGetParameterRelativeScope ( $paramName, $expectedValue )

testGetParameterSpecificScope() public méthode

public testGetParameterSpecificScope ( $paramName, $expectedValue )

testGetSetDefaultScope() public méthode

testGetSetUndefinedStrategy() public méthode

testHasParameterNoNamespace() public méthode

public testHasParameterNoNamespace ( $defaultMatch, $groupMatch, $scopeMatch, $globalMatch, $expectedResult )

testHasParameterWithNamespaceAndScope() public méthode

public testHasParameterWithNamespaceAndScope ( $defaultMatch, $groupMatch, $scopeMatch, $globalMatch, $expectedResult )